> An open-source book that tells how to build a Linux system completely
> from source. Sounds cool. But isn't this pretty much Gentoo without
> the community and Portage?

Probably not. Gentoo gives you tools to build your system, while LFS requires 
you to do everything by hand. Yes, I know there are scripts to automate an 
LFS installation, but after things are installed, you're on your own again 
for upgrades, AFAIK.

Aslo, there are no ports-like userland applications repositories, unless there 
happens to be something in Beyond Linux From Scratch.

Problem I have with LFS is it requires you have a full working system to
begin with .. with gentoo you still get an LFS feel while getting just
the basic tools to start a system similiar to LFS. What most do not
realize is you could install portage on top of LFS, but I have always
said if you do that you should just run gentoo to begin with :) .
